Phrases that express similar concepts, ordered by semantic similarity:
a loose sheet of paper
Uses "loose" to suggest that the paper is not bound or attached.
an extra sheet
Simple substitution with "extra" conveying the meaning of additional or separate.
an individual page
Replaces "sheet" with "page" and "separate" with "individual", emphasizing the distinctness of the paper.
a distinct page
Focuses on the uniqueness of the page by using "distinct".
a different piece of paper
Uses "different" and "piece" to indicate a unique and detached paper.
a detached piece of paper
Uses "detached" instead of "separate" and "piece" instead of "sheet", highlighting the physical separation.
a new page
Focuses on the novelty and separateness of the page.
a stand-alone paper
Employs "stand-alone" to convey the independence of the sheet.
a supplementary document
Replaces "sheet of paper" with "document", indicating a more formal or official attachment.
an accompanying page
Substitutes "separate" with "accompanying", focusing on the association with a main document, and replaces "sheet" with "page".
FAQs
How can I use "a separate sheet of paper" in a sentence?
You might say, "Please complete the calculations on "a separate sheet of paper" and submit it with your assignment".
What is an alternative to using "a separate sheet of paper"?
Alternatives include using "an additional page" or "a supplementary document", depending on the context.
When is it appropriate to ask for information to be provided on "a separate sheet of paper"?
It's appropriate when the original form or document doesn't provide enough space or when you need to keep the original document clean and uncluttered.
Is it better to say "a separate sheet of paper" or "an additional sheet of paper"?
Both phrases are acceptable, but "a separate sheet of paper" emphasizes that the sheet is not part of the original document, while "an additional sheet of paper" simply indicates that it's extra.
